Sec. 224.006. PAYMENT TO COUNTY OR MUNICIPALITY.

(a)On delivery to the department of acceptable instruments conveying to the state the requested right-of-way, the department shall prepare and transmit to the comptroller vouchers covering the payment to the county or municipality of the department's share of the cost of acquiring the right-of-way.
(b)The comptroller shall issue warrants on the appropriate account covering the state's obligation as evidenced by the vouchers.

Legislative History

Acts 1995, 74th Leg., ch. 165, Sec. 1, eff. Sept. 1, 1995.
